Neighborhood Overview
The Pensacola Bay Center is situated in the heart of downtown Pensacola, providing excellent access to the city's vibrant cultural and dining districts. The venue is easily reachable via Interstate 110, which connects directly to the downtown grid and simplifies travel for those arriving from outside the immediate area. While surface parking lots surround the arena, high-attendance events often require arriving early to secure a spot within a comfortable walking distance. Pensacola International Airport (PNS) is the primary gateway for air travelers, located approximately 10 to 15 minutes away by car depending on local traffic conditions.
Navigating the downtown area is generally straightforward, though the streets surrounding the arena become quite congested immediately before and after games. Rideshare services are a popular and efficient way to reach the venue without the stress of managing event-day parking. For the best experience, plan your arrival at least 45 minutes before the puck drops to allow ample time for security screening and finding your seat. If you prefer walking, the downtown area features wide sidewalks and clear signage that makes moving between your hotel and the arena simple and safe.

Pensacola Museum of History
1.2 miLocated just a short drive from the arena, this museum offers a deep dive into the rich and diverse history of the Pensacola area. The exhibits cover everything from early Spanish colonization to the city's role in the development of the Gulf Coast. It is a fantastic option for families or groups looking to learn more about the region's cultural heritage. The facility is well-maintained and provides a quiet, educational escape from the noise of the city streets.
Historic Pensacola Village
1.5 miThis living history museum features several restored buildings that offer a glimpse into life in Pensacola during the 18th and 19th centuries. Visitors can walk through period-accurate homes and explore gardens that reflect the historical landscape of the city. It is a great destination for those interested in architecture and local heritage. The site provides a peaceful atmosphere that contrasts beautifully with the high-energy events held at the nearby sports arena.

Weather & Seasons
Winter
Winter in Pensacola is mild and pleasant, with daytime temperatures rarely dropping too low. You will likely only need a light jacket for the evenings, especially if you are walking between the arena and downtown. It is a very comfortable time to visit, as the humidity is significantly lower than in the summer months.
Spring & early summer
This is a beautiful time to visit, characterized by blooming flowers and warm, sunny days. It is perfect for walking, though you should be prepared for occasional afternoon showers. Pack layers, as the mornings can be cool while the afternoons warm up quickly, making for a very comfortable event-day experience.
Mid-summer
Expect high heat and significant humidity during these months, which can make outdoor walking quite intense. It is best to plan your travel to the arena for the cooler parts of the day or rely on rideshare services. Stay hydrated and dress in light, breathable fabrics to remain comfortable while you are out and about.
Fall season
Fall brings a welcome break from the intense summer heat, offering some of the most enjoyable weather of the year. The temperatures are perfect for exploring the downtown district on foot, and the evenings are crisp and refreshing. It is a fantastic season to plan a trip for an indoor event.
Rain & snow
Rain is common in Pensacola, particularly in the form of brief but intense afternoon thunderstorms during the warmer months. Always carry a small umbrella or a light rain jacket to stay dry while walking to the arena. Snow is extremely rare in this region, so you will not need to prepare for winter weather conditions.
